Large constellations of artificial satellites are beginning to interfere with astronomical observing. Visual magnitude measurements of these spacecraft are useful for monitoring and characterizing their brightness. This paper describes the method used for recording brightness by eye.

  1. Characterization of Starlink Direct-to-Cell Satellites In Brightness Mitigation Mode

    astro-ph.IM 2025-02 conditional novelty 6.0 of 10

    Starlink Direct-to-Cell satellites in brightness mitigation mode have a mean apparent magnitude of 5.16 and remain about twice as bright as Starlink internet satellites at the same distance.
